Property Details for 11 Mooramie Ave, Kensington

11 Mooramie Ave, Kensington is a 5 bedroom, 1 bathroom House with 3 parking spaces and was built in 1935. The property has a land size of 594m2 and floor size of 166m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in August 2023.

About Kensington 2033

The size of Kensington is approximately 2.7 square kilometres. It has 21 parks covering nearly 28.4% of total area. The population of Kensington in 2011 was 12,776 people. By 2016 the population was 14,993 showing a population growth of 17.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Kensington is 20-29 years. Households in Kensington are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Kensington work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 45.2% of the homes in Kensington were owner-occupied compared with 38.9% in 2016.
